Roof Valleys: The Hidden Leak Point on Harrogate's Period Roofs
There’s a part of your roof that handles more water than any other, gets the least attention, and causes a surprising share of the leaks a Harrogate roofer gets called out to. It’s the valley - the internal angle where two roof slopes meet and run together. Rain from two whole slopes funnels down that single channel, so if there’s a weak point anywhere on it, that’s where the water finds its way in. On the town’s older houses the problem is doubled, because Victorian and Edwardian rooflines are full of valleys - all those L-shaped plans, dormers and bay windows create them. When a period Harrogate home gets a leak that isn’t the chimney and isn’t a slipped slate, the valley is the usual suspect. Here’s how valleys work, why they fail, and what it takes to put one right.

What a valley is, and why it’s a weak spot
A valley is the trough formed where two pitched roof surfaces meet at an internal angle, like the inside of a folded piece of paper. Its job is to collect the water running off both slopes and carry it down to the gutter. That’s a lot of water passing over one narrow strip of roof, which is exactly why it’s vulnerable.
Everywhere else on a roof, the tiles or slates simply shed water down the slope. In the valley, the water is concentrated and channelled, often moving fast in heavy rain, and it’s relying on whatever lines the valley - lead, tile or fibreglass - to stay watertight under that load. Any crack, gap, blockage or worn spot in that lining, and the water backs up and gets underneath the roof covering. A fault that would be harmless in the middle of a slope becomes a leak in a valley.
Why Harrogate’s period roofs have so many
Simple roofs - a plain rectangle with two slopes - have no valleys at all. The trouble is that almost none of Harrogate’s period housing is that simple. The Victorian and Edwardian villas and terraces that fill the town were built with far more interesting rooflines: L-shaped and T-shaped plans, projecting gables, bay windows with their own little roofs, and dormers set into the slopes.

Every one of those features creates a valley where its roof meets the main roof. A typical Harrogate semi might have two or three; a larger villa with multiple gables and a bay can have half a dozen. More valleys means more of these high-risk channels to maintain, and it’s a big part of why period roofs here need more attention at the junctions than a modern estate house ever will. It’s the same reason the town’s roofs are heavy on lead flashing - complex shapes mean more joints.
The types of valley you’ll find
Not all valleys are built the same, and the type you have shapes how it fails and how it’s fixed. The traditional one is an open lead valley: a wide strip of lead dressed into the trough with the tiles or slates stopping short on either side, leaving the lead channel open to view. Done well it’s excellent and lasts for decades.

Then there’s the closed or mitred valley, where the tiles are cut and laced across the join so no lining shows - neat, but only as good as the cutting and the secret gutter beneath. Older properties sometimes have a mortar-bedded valley, which is the one most prone to cracking with age. And the modern option is a GRP (fibreglass) dry valley: a preformed channel that’s quick to fit, formed in one piece with no joints to fail. When an old valley is beyond repair, a GRP conversion is often the sensible replacement.
Why valleys leak
Most valley failures come down to one of three things. The first is the lining wearing out or cracking. A lead valley suffers the same problem as lead flashing - if the lead was laid in over-long lengths it can’t expand and contract freely, so it fatigues and splits, usually right in the fast-flowing centre where a crack does the most damage. Old mortar valleys simply crack with age and frost.

The second is blockage, and it’s the one homeowners cause without realising. Leaves, moss and debris collect in the valley because everything washing off both slopes ends up there. Once it dams up, water backs up over the edges of the lining and straight under the tiles. On a tree-lined Harrogate street this happens every autumn, which is why keeping valleys clear matters as much as keeping gutters clear. The third is bad original detailing - a valley cut too narrow, or a secret gutter with too little overlap - which no amount of maintenance fully cures and which needs re-forming to fix.
The signs your valley is the problem
Valley leaks have a signature. Because the valley runs down the middle of the roof rather than at the edge, the water usually shows up as a damp patch or ceiling stain some way in from the outside wall, often tracking down a line rather than spreading from a corner. If your leak is nowhere near the chimney and nowhere near an outside wall, a valley is high on the list.

Up close, the tell-tales are a valley full of debris or thick with moss, visible cracks or splits in a lead or mortar valley, and tiles alongside the valley that have slipped or lifted. From inside the loft, damp or stained timbers running along the line of the valley confirm it. Repairing or replacing a valley
What’s needed depends on the valley and how far gone it is. A blocked valley just needs clearing and the surrounding tiles checking - cheap and quick, and often all it takes. A lead valley with a single split can sometimes be patched, but if the lead has fatigued in one place it’s usually tired all over, so a re-line is the lasting fix rather than chasing cracks.

Replacing a valley means lifting the tiles or slates along both sides, taking out the old lining, and forming a new one - either fresh lead worked in proper lengths, or a GRP dry valley. It’s more involved than a flashing repair because the roof covering has to come up and go back, but on the right roof a GRP conversion is durable, jointless and often more economical than re-leading. What valley work costs
The range is wide because “valley work” covers everything from a ten-minute clear-out to a full re-line with scaffold. Clearing a blocked valley and re-bedding a few tiles is a modest job, often a few hundred pounds or bundled into a general maintenance visit. A full valley replacement - stripping back, new lining, re-laying the covering - typically runs from several hundred pounds up to well over a thousand per valley, driven mostly by length, the covering type and whether scaffold is needed to reach it.

As always, access is the swing factor: a valley low over a single-storey bay is cheap to reach, while one high on a two-storey villa needs proper scaffold. The thing not to do is ignore it - a leaking valley soaks the roof structure continuously, and the repair only gets bigger. Should I replace my lead valley with a GRP one?
Often, yes. If a lead valley has fatigued and cracked, a GRP (fibreglass) dry valley is a durable and frequently more economical replacement, formed in one piece with no joints to fail. On a listed building or in a conservation area, lead may be required to keep the original appearance, so it depends on the property. A roofer can advise which suits your roof and setting.
